FTX Trading Ltd.: A Once-Prominent Player

FTX Trading Ltd., also known as FTX, was a cryptocurrency exchange and hedge fund that captivated the industry with its innovative offerings. Founded in 2019 by Sam Bankman-Fried and Gary Wang, FTX quickly rose to prominence, garnering a large user base and establishing itself as a formidable player in the market. However, beneath the veneer of success, cracks began to appear, ultimately culminating in a catastrophic collapse.

The Fallout: Crypto Prices Plummet

Following the demise of FTX and other major players in the cryptocurrency space in 2022, the market plunged into a state of turmoil. Prices across various cryptocurrencies experienced a sharp decline, leaving investors reeling from the sudden downturn. The crash not only wiped out significant gains but also cast a shadow of doubt over the future of the industry.

The Ripple Effect: Regulatory Crackdown

The crash of FTX and other prominent entities in the cryptocurrency sector served as a wake-up call for regulators worldwide. The widespread malpractices and fraudulent activities that came to light in the aftermath of these events prompted a swift and stringent regulatory crackdown. Authorities moved to tighten oversight and impose stricter measures to protect investors and prevent similar incidents from recurring.
